WHAT ISTHE BIG IDEA?
Experience and training should
work together in law enforcement
We have all heard some form of the statement, "Those who can, do. Those who can't, teach.” While most of us would agree that there is no substitute for real world experience, the reality is that no one can experience every situation on their own.
To truly be professional, today’s LEO must invest in him or herself and not wait for the department to shoulder the responsibility.
Experience can teach us a lot about ourselves. It can make us aware of our skills, our strengths, and our weaknesses.
